https://bugs.kde.org/show_bug.cgi?id=449326
Fabian Vogt <fab...@ritter-vogt.de> changed: What |Removed |Added ---------------------------------------------------------------------------- CC| |fab...@ritter-vogt.de --- Comment #7 from Fabian Vogt <fab...@ritter-vogt.de> --- openQA encounters this regularly (almost every run) as well, and I can reproduce it locally. The reason appears to be that $DISPLAY is set in the activation environment, and so kwin tries to use the X11 backend with the old value of $DISPLAY. This is not unset by cleanupPlasmaEnvironment on logout because it is already part of the "oldSystemdEnvironment". Doing just that would only address it partially though, it's still possible for it to be set by an improperly terminated Plasma session or just after switching from a different DE which doesn't unset $DISPLAY. If it's not "supported" to start a nested session, I suggest to just unset $DISPLAY in startplasma-wayland. If it is, then checking for `XDG_SESSION_TYPE=x11` before might be an option. $WAYLAND_DISPLAY is probably similarly affected, but that is at least cleaned up properly by startplasma-wayland. Jan 29 15:33:51 localhost.localdomain kwin_wayland_wrapper[2162]: No backend specified through command line argument, trying auto resolution Jan 29 15:33:51 localhost.localdomain kwin_wayland_wrapper[2162]: Inval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 key Jan 29 15:33:51 localhost.localdomain kwin_wayland_wrapper[2173]: No backend specified through command line argument, trying auto resolution Jan 29 15:33:51 localhost.localdomain kwin_wayland_wrapper[2173]: Inval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 key Jan 29 15:33:51 localhost.localdomain kwin_wayland_wrapper[2175]: No backend specified through command line argument, trying auto resolution Jan 29 15:33:51 localhost.localdomain kwin_wayland_wrapper[2175]: Inval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 key Jan 29 15:33:51 localhost.localdomain kwin_wayland_wrapper[2177]: No backend specified through command line argument, trying auto resolution Jan 29 15:33:51 localhost.localdomain kwin_wayland_wrapper[2177]: Inval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 key Jan 29 15:33:51 localhost.localdomain kwin_wayland_wrapper[2179]: No backend specified through command line argument, trying auto resolution Jan 29 15:33:51 localhost.localdomain kwin_wayland_wrapper[2179]: Inval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 key Jan 29 15:33:51 localhost.localdomain kwin_wayland_wrapper[2182]: No backend specified through command line argument, trying auto resolution Jan 29 15:33:51 localhost.localdomain kwin_wayland_wrapper[2182]: Inval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 key Jan 29 15:33:51 localhost.localdomain kwin_wayland_wrapper[2184]: No backend specified through command line argument, trying auto resolution Jan 29 15:33:51 localhost.localdomain kwin_wayland_wrapper[2184]: Inval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 key Jan 29 15:33:51 localhost.localdomain kwin_wayland_wrapper[2186]: No backend specified through command line argument, trying auto resolution Jan 29 15:33:51 localhost.localdomain kwin_wayland_wrapper[2186]: Inval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 key Jan 29 15:33:51 localhost.localdomain kwin_wayland_wrapper[2188]: No backend specified through command line argument, trying auto resolution Jan 29 15:33:51 localhost.localdomain kwin_wayland_wrapper[2188]: Inval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 key Jan 29 15:33:51 localhost.localdomain kwin_wayland_wrapper[2190]: No backend specified through command line argument, trying auto resolution Jan 29 15:33:51 localhost.localdomain kwin_wayland_wrapper[2190]: Inval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 key Jan 29 15:33:51 localhost.localdomain kwin_wayland_wrapper[2192]: No backend specified through command line argument, trying auto resolution Jan 29 15:33:51 localhost.localdomain kcminit_startup[2166]: The Wayland connection broke. Did the Wayland compositor die? Jan 29 15:33:51 localhost.localdomain ksplashqml[2165]: The Wayland connection broke. Did the Wayland compositor die? Jan 29 15:33:51 localhost.localdomain kwin_wayland_wrapper[2192]: Invalid MIT-MAGIC-COOKIE-1 keyInvalid MIT-MAGIC-COOKIE-1 key Jan 29 15:33:51 localhost.localdomain systemd[1371]: Started KDE Config Module Initialization. Jan 29 15:33:51 localhost.localdomain systemd[1371]: Starting KDE Daemon... Jan 29 15:33:51 localhost.localdomain systemd[1371]: Starting KDE Session Management Server... Jan 29 15:33:51 localhost.localdomain systemd[1371]: plasma-ksplash.service: Main process exited, code=exited, status=1/FAILURE Jan 29 15:33:51 localhost.localdomain systemd[1371]: plasma-ksplash.service: Failed with result 'exit-code'. Jan 29 15:33:51 localhost.localdomain systemd[1371]: Failed to start Splash screen shown during boot. Jan 29 15:33:51 localhost.localdomain kded5[2194]: Failed to create wl_display (No such file or directory) Jan 29 15:33:51 localhost.localdomain kded5[2194]: qt.qpa.plugin: Could not load the Qt platform plugin "wayland" in "" even though it was found. Jan 29 15:33:51 localhost.localdomain kded5[2194]: This application failed to start because no Qt platform plugin could be initialized. Reinstalling the application may fix this problem. Available platform plugins are: eglfs, linuxfb, minimal, minimalegl, offscreen, vnc, wayland-egl, wayland, wayland-xcomposite-egl, wayland-xcomposite-glx, xcb -- You are receiving this mail because: You are watching all bug changes.